Delta Airlines Carry-On Size Rules
For each passenger, you can take 1 carry-on bag and 1 personal item! Make sure that your bag is correctly measured before you hop on a journey on Delta Air Lines.
Item Type | Maximum Dimensions (inches) | Notes |
Carry-on bag | 22 x 14 x 9 | Includes wheels and handles |
Personal item | 18 x 14 x 8 | Examples: backpack, laptop bag, purse |
Key Notes:
- Carry-on bag must fit in the overhead bin.
- Personal items must fit under the seat in front of you.
- If bins are full, Delta may require you to check your carry-on even if it meets size limits.
Delta Carry-On Bag Weight Limits
There's no strict weight limit on carry-on luggage. But you can still follow these tricks to enhance your experience with Delta Air Lines!
- Most travelers can comfortably lift up to 40 lbs (18 kg).
- Overly heavy carry-ons may be required to be checked at the gate.

Carry-On Luggage Size Delta vs. Checked Baggage
Feature | Carry-On Bag | Checked Bag |
Max Dimensions | 22 x 14 x 9 inches | 62 inches (length + width + height) |
Max Weight | No strict limit (practical: 40 lbs) | About 50 lbs per bag |
Storage Location | Overhead bin | Cargo hold |
Access During Flight | Yes | No |
Fees | Mostly free | May incur fees depending on fare and route |

Delta Carry-On: Limit Liquids
Follow TSA’s 3-1-1 rule:
- Containers ≤ 3.4 ounces (100 ml)
- All liquids fit in 1 quart-sized clear bag
- One bag per passenger

What You Can and Cannot Pack in a Delta Carry-On?
Items You Can Pack for Delta Carry-On:
- Clothing and shoes
- Toiletries (within TSA 3-1-1 rules)
- Electronics (laptops, tablets, phones, cameras)
- Books, magazines, and travel documents
- Snacks
- Small duty-free items purchased at the airport
- Foldable travel accessories like umbrellas and hats
Items You Cannot Pack for Delta Carry-On:
- Sharp objects (knives, scissors over 4 inches)
- Firearms, ammunition, explosives
- Flammable materials (lighters, gasoline)
- Large sports equipment (e.g., baseball bats, golf clubs) without prior approval
- Liquids exceeding 3.4 ounces must be checked
- Certain batteries or oversized power banks
Exceptions & Tips for Delta Carry-On:
- Infant equipment (strollers, car seats) is allowed in addition to carry-on.
- Medical devices (oxygen tanks, CPAP machines) may be allowed but require notification.

FAQs about Delta Carry-On Size
What is the maximum delta carry on size allowed?
22 x 14 x 9 inches (56 x 35 x 23 cm), including handles and wheels.Can I bring a personal item with my delta carry on size?
Yes, one personal item like a backpack or purse is allowed in addition to your carry-on.Are there weight limits for delta carry on size?
Delta does not have a strict weight limit, but you must be able to lift it into the overhead bin.What happens if my bag exceeds delta carry on size?
Oversized bags must be checked and may incur additional fees.
